Output 577cf632707f078d2cd54b99eb9965496571e94cef3bd6a71462526eb2f26c33:2

value
81692
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5420f01a70dd8ef6a233cbd0eab1ab01f37f7c9 OP_EQUALVERIFY OP_CHECKSIG
address
1MuCsmDyRLQU23qAASY1xixRfdQ9Wf19Ws
transaction
577cf632707f078d2cd54b99eb9965496571e94cef3bd6a71462526eb2f26c33
confirmations
551864
spent
true